System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 显示方法、电子设备以及介质技术_技高网

显示方法、电子设备以及介质技术

技术编号:41294512 阅读:23 留言:0更新日期:2024-05-13 14:44
本申请涉及计算机技术领域,公开了一种显示方法,包括,显示第一应用的第一窗口,其中,第一窗口具有第一尺寸和对应第一尺寸的第一显示方式;响应用户针对第一窗口的第一操作,显示第一应用的具有第二尺寸和对应第二尺寸的第二显示方式的第二窗口、以及具有第三尺寸和对应第三尺寸的第三显示方式的第一窗口,其中,第二尺寸和第三尺寸不同,第二显示方式和第三显示方式不同。基于此,在第一窗口与第二窗口的尺寸大小不同的情况下,第一窗口由于以对应于自身实际的第三尺寸对应的显示方式显示,就不会出现布局问题。

【技术实现步骤摘要】

本申请涉及计算机,特别涉及一种显示方法、电子设备以及介质


技术介绍

1、随着计算机技术的发展,电子设备的功能越来越完善。电子设备的屏幕上可以显示丰富的内容。为了满足更多的用户需求,电子设备可以一同显示同一个应用的多个窗口。比如说,平板就可以同时显示新闻应用程序(application)的多个窗口。

2、可以理解的,当平板显示有当前应用窗口,当用户点击当前窗口中的某个控件或者链接,电子设备可以同时显示当前应用窗口,以及响应于用户点击某个控件或者链接所打开的同一应用的新的窗口,由于电子设备会按照新打开的窗口的窗口配置属性调整当前应用窗口的的窗口配置属性,导致在一些情况下(例如新打开的窗口尺寸与当前应用窗口不同),此时当前应用窗口中的控件、文字、图片等显示异常。

3、例如,图1a示出了在平板100上显示的对应于新闻应用程序(application)的一个竖屏(高大于宽)新闻主窗口01,该新闻主窗口01包括多条推荐信息,例如图中示出的3条推荐信息分别为001、002以及003。可以理解的,每条推荐信息都有与之对应的详情窗口。当平板100响应于用户点击推荐信息002(推荐信息002包括男子运动xx的文字以及文字下方的图片p002)的操作后,打开了如图1b中所示一个新的横屏(高h1小于宽w2)的详情窗口02,并且与竖屏(高h1大于宽w1)新闻主窗口01'一同显示。

4、由于新打开的详情窗口02是横屏的,新闻主窗口01'是竖屏的,详情窗口02与新闻主窗口01'的尺寸不同,而电子设备将新打开的详情窗口02的尺寸所对应的窗口配置属性作为新闻主窗口01'的窗口配置属性,此时新闻主窗口01'上的图片、文字等基于与自身实际尺寸不匹配的显示参数显示时,存在显示异常问题。例如,图片p002'以横屏的详情窗口02的尺寸对应的显示方法显示,显示时与图1a中的图片p002相比占据整个竖屏新闻主窗口01'过大,推荐信息001、002以及003消失了,竖屏的新闻主窗口01'中的图片、文字以及空间等布局异常,从而影响用户体验。


技术实现思路

1、为了解决上述问题,本申请实施例的目的在于提供一种显示方法、电子设备以及介质,使得电子设备在显示第一应用的具有第一尺寸的第一窗口下,在检测到用户操作后,响应用户针对第一窗口的第一操作,显示第一应用的具有第二尺寸和对应第二尺寸的第二显示方式的第二窗口、以及具有第三尺寸和对应第三尺寸的第三显示方式的第一窗口,其中,所示第二尺寸和所述第三尺寸不同,所述第二显示方式和所述第三显示方式不同。基于此,在第一窗口的第三尺寸与第二窗口的第二尺寸大小不同的情况下,第一窗口由于以对应于自身实际的第三尺寸对应的显示方式显示,避免出现布局异常的问题。

2、第一方面,本申请实施例提供了一种显示方法,应用于电子设备,包括,

3、显示第一应用的第一窗口,其中,所述第一窗口具有第一尺寸和对应所述第一尺寸的第一显示方式;

4、响应用户针对所述第一窗口的第一操作,显示第一应用的具有第二尺寸和对应第二尺寸的第二显示方式的第二窗口、以及具有第三尺寸和对应第三尺寸的第三显示方式的第一窗口,其中,所示第二尺寸和所述第三尺寸不同,所述第二显示方式和所述第三显示方式不同。

5、可以理解的,在显示的第一窗口的第三尺寸与第二窗口的第二尺寸大小不同的情况下,将第一窗口以对应于自身实际的第三尺寸对应的显示方式显示,此时第一窗口就不会出现布局异常的问题。例如,图5a中示出的新闻主页面01'以对应于自身实际显示的第三尺寸对应的显示方式显示,此时新闻主页面01'显示时布局没有出现异常。

6、在上述第一方面的一种可能实现中,所述第一显示方式、第二显示方式以及第三显示方式包括以下显示参数中的至少一种:

7、显示窗口中显示元素的大小、位置、颜色。

8、可以理解的,显示窗口中显示元素可以包括图片、控件、文字等。

9、在上述第一方面的一种可能实现中,所述第一操作包括点击所述第一窗口中的第一显示条目,并且

10、所述第二窗口用于显示对应所述第一显示条目的显示内容。

11、例如,第一显示条目可以为如图1a中所示的新闻主页面01中的推荐信息001、推荐信息002、推荐信息003,并且第二窗口为对应前述各推荐信息的详情窗口。

12、在上述第一方面的一种可能实现中,所述第一操作包括点击所述第一窗口外的第二显示条目,并且

13、所述第二窗口用于显示对应所述第二显示条目的显示内容。

14、例如,第一应用为日历应用,日历控件1002与日历控件1001对应同一日历应用。第二显示条目可以为如图4a中所示的日历控件1002或者日历控件1001。当第一窗口对应于日历控件1001,则第二窗口对应于日历控件1002;第一窗口对应于日历控件1002,则第二窗口对应于日历控件1001。

15、在上述第一方面的一种可能实现中,所述第一尺寸和所述第三尺寸相同,所述第一显示方式和所述第三显示方式相同。

16、例如,如图1a中所示的新闻主页面01与图5a所示的新闻主页面01'的尺寸相同。

17、在上述第一方面的一种可能实现中,所述第一尺寸和所述第三尺寸不同,所述第一显示方式和所述第三显示方式不同。

18、例如,如图1a中所示的新闻主页面01与图5a所示的新闻主页面01'的尺寸不同。

19、在上述第一方面的一种可能实现中,所述第一窗口的高宽比大于1,所述第二窗口的高宽比小于1。

20、在上述第一方面的一种可能实现中,所述第一应用包括新闻应用、日历应用、购物网站应用、词典应用、即时通讯应用、浏览器应用、视频/音频播放应用中的至少一种。

21、在上述第一方面的一种可能实现中,所述第一窗口和所述第二窗口处于第一应用的第一进程。

22、在上述第一方面的一种可能实现中,还包括:

23、显示所述第一应用的第一窗口的同时,还显示具有所述第一尺寸和所述第一显示方式的第三窗口;

24、响应于用户针对所述第一窗口的第二操作,改变第一窗口的大小为第四尺寸,并以对应所述第四尺寸的第四显示方式显示所述第一窗口的内容,并且

25、对应于所述第三窗口的尺寸保持为所述第一尺寸,保持以所述第一显示方式显示所述第三窗口的内容。

26、例如,第二操作可以为点击第一窗口上的可以改变第一窗口尺寸的条目,例如横竖屏切换控件。

27、在上述第一方面的一种可能实现中,还包括:

28、显示所述第一应用的第一窗口的同时,还显示具有所述第一尺寸和所述第一显示方式的第四窗口;

29、响应于用户针对所述第一窗口的第三操作,改变第一窗口的大小为第五尺寸,并以对应所述第五尺寸的第五显示方式显示所述第一窗口的内容,并且

30、对应于所述第四窗口的尺寸更改为第六尺寸,并且以所述第六尺寸对应的第六显示方式显示本文档来自技高网...

【技术保护点】

1.一种显示方法,应用于电子设备,其特征在于,包括,

2.根据权利要求1所述的方法,其特征在于,所述第一显示方式、第二显示方式以及第三显示方式包括以下显示参数中的至少一种:

3.根据权利要求1所述的方法,其特征在于,所述第一操作包括点击所述第一窗口中的第一显示条目,并且

4.根据权利要求1所述的方法,其特征在于,所述第一操作包括点击所述第一窗口外的第二显示条目,并且

5.根据权利要求1所述的方法,其特征在于,所述第一尺寸和所述第三尺寸相同,所述第一显示方式和所述第三显示方式相同。

6.根据权利要求1所述的方法,其特征在于,所述第一尺寸和所述第三尺寸不同,所述第一显示方式和所述第三显示方式不同。

7.根据权利要求1-6中任一项所述的方法,其特征在于,所述第一窗口的高宽比大于1,所述第二窗口的高宽比小于1。

8.根据权利要求1-6中任一项所述的方法,其特征在于,所述第一应用包括新闻应用、日历应用、购物网站应用、词典应用、即时通讯应用、浏览器应用、视频/音频播放应用中的至少一种。

9.根据权利要求1-6中任一项所述的方法,其特征在于,所述第一窗口和所述第二窗口处于第一应用的第一进程。

10.根据权利要求1所述的方法,其特征在于,还包括:

11.根据权利要求1所述的方法,其特征在于,还包括:

12.一种电子设备,其特征在于,包括:

13.一种计算机可读存储介质,其特征在于,所述存储介质上存储有指令,所述指令在计算机上执行时使所述计算机执行权利要求1-11中任一项所述的显示方法。

14.一种计算机程序产品,其特征在于,所述计算机程序产品包括指令,该指令在执行时使计算机执行权利要求1-11中任一项所述的显示方法。

...

【技术特征摘要】

1.一种显示方法,应用于电子设备,其特征在于,包括,

2.根据权利要求1所述的方法,其特征在于,所述第一显示方式、第二显示方式以及第三显示方式包括以下显示参数中的至少一种:

3.根据权利要求1所述的方法,其特征在于,所述第一操作包括点击所述第一窗口中的第一显示条目,并且

4.根据权利要求1所述的方法,其特征在于,所述第一操作包括点击所述第一窗口外的第二显示条目,并且

5.根据权利要求1所述的方法,其特征在于,所述第一尺寸和所述第三尺寸相同,所述第一显示方式和所述第三显示方式相同。

6.根据权利要求1所述的方法,其特征在于,所述第一尺寸和所述第三尺寸不同,所述第一显示方式和所述第三显示方式不同。

7.根据权利要求1-6中任一项所述的方法,其特征在于,所述第一窗口的高宽比大于1,所述第二窗口的高宽比小于1。

【专利技术属性】
技术研发人员:何书杰蔡世宗
申请(专利权)人:华为终端有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1